10. Returns of Goods
10.1. High-quality goods can be returned within 14 days from the date of their receipt. Any defects in defective (non-conforming) goods that have been sold are remedied, and such goods are replaced or returned in accordance with the provisions of the Civil Code of the Republic of Lithuania.
10.2. When returning goods, the following conditions must be met: 10.2.1. The returned goods must be in their original, undamaged packaging (this requirement does not apply when returning defective goods);
10.2.2. The goods must not be damaged by the Buyer;
10.2.3. The goods must be unused and retain their commercial appearance (labels, protective films, etc. must not be damaged or removed). This requirement does not apply when returning defective goods;
10.2.4. The returned goods must include the same set/contents as originally received by the Buyer (this requirement does not apply when returning defective goods);
10.2.5. The Seller has the right to refuse to accept the returned goods if the return conditions have not been observed;
10.2.6. Goods must be returned in the manner specified by the Seller within 14 (fourteen) days from the date of receipt (this provision does not apply to defective goods – in such a case, returns are carried out during the statutory warranty period).
10.3. The return and exchange of goods of suitable quality are carried out in accordance with Article 6.22810(1) of the Civil Code.
10.4. The amount paid for goods that the Buyer has received but subsequently refused is refunded to the Buyer’s account no later than within 5 (five) days from the date the goods are returned to the Seller, unless the Seller and the Buyer agree otherwise.
